CHEVY HIGH PERFORMANCE 1994 JUNE - GOTTLEIB'S BIG RED
Within this issue you will discover the following topics:
1) SS MYSTIQUE: Chevelle Expert Mike Mueller Explains the Power Behind Super Sports
2) CORNERING MUSCLE: Our Cover Car Gets the Royal Treatment From Suspension Techniques
3) HANGING SHEETMETAL: Scott Baker Makes Sure All the Lines on This Chevelle Are Straight
4) WHAT'S IN A NUMBER? Looking for the Right SS 396 Part? Check This List From Jeff Lilly
5) CHEVELLE SHOPPING: A Huge Guide to Finding Resto and Performance Parts for Your Chevelle
6) HELL's CHEVELLES: Here Are Our Choices for the 10 Hottest Street Chevelles of All Time
7) ROCKET LAUNCHER: Scoggin-Dickey Uses the Rocket Block to Build a 675hp 434ci Mouse
8) LONG AND WINDING ROD: A Peek Inside a Racing Engine That Uses 6.250-lnch Connecting Rods
9) CAMARO RESTO SHOP: We Show You Step by Step How to Rebuild Your Quadrajet Carburetor
10) THREE-STAGE BEAUTY: Chuck Watkin's Sharp Little Nova Has Undergone Three Performance Transformations
11) PANIC MOUSE: Rick Souza Doesn't Have a Small-Block in This Downsized '57 Pro Mod
12) AJ'S TOY: Mark & Stephanie Rice's Hot Pro Street '69 Camaro
13) BIG RED ONE: We Ride Alone in the Absolute Baddest Street-Legal Camaro Ever Built...the Gottleib's Wicked '69
14) BLACK BEAUTY: Here's Hans Jakobs' 11-Second Street Chevelle That Stands Out, Even in the Dark
